    <description>The Court directed the petitioner to submit a representation detailing the form of security they intend to furnish in place of the tax demand, instructing the authority to reconsider the matter, disregarding the previous order. The petitioner was given a two-week deadline to submit the representation, after which the authority would pass an appropriate order following the law. The writ petition was disposed of with these directions.</description>
